General match analysis

Wacker Innsbruck are second in the table and have won 4 of their last 5 matches, scoring as many as 14 goals and conceding just 3 during that period. At home, the hosts won their only match so far, scoring 5 goals, keeping a clean sheet and averaging 8 shots on target from 15 attempts. St. Pölten have lost all 3 league matches, failed to score in any of them, and have a 100% rate of both scoreless games and defeats away from home. The visitors do create chances worth an average of 1.51 xG on the road, but they fail to convert them, while Wacker record 1.82 xG at home and an exceptionally high 33% shot conversion rate. The clear difference in form, efficiency and the hosts’ quality on their own ground points to a Wacker Innsbruck victory.
